The European Union finds itself at a crossroads in its path towards decarbonization. On the one hand, there is a continuous need to substitute Russian energy with alternative supplies to ensure energy security. On the other, the urgency in shifting towards renewable energy sources has never been greater. In 2021, as part of the Fit-for-55 legislative package, the European Commission proposed raising the EU’s minimum share of renewable energy sources in final energy consumption for 2030 from 32% to 40%. Less than a year later, in response to the energy market disruption caused by the Russian invasion of Ukraine, the Commission proposed increasing the target to 45% as part of its REPowerEU plan.
 
This webinar will discuss the newly proposed target and reflect on obstacles and supporting measures for the further deployment of renewables under the current energy crisis. Some questions to discuss include: What can be expected in the negotiations on the proposed 45% target and the amendment to the Renewable Energy Directive? How will the decision to classify renewable energy plants and electricity grids and storage as an ‘overriding public interest’ accelerate their deployment? What are the keys to strengthening the EU’s solar PV and wind sector’s value chain? How do stakeholders assess the rules that are being proposed to accelerate and simplify permit-granting procedures? What are the main obstacles in implementing the Commission’s recommendations on facilitating Power Purchase Agreements?
